Output ce233e31aa19d0c42d843170549a64dea433495e02a1385bd24836b3665183f6:7

value
511646
script pubkey
OP_0 OP_PUSHBYTES_20 4b9eb6a279455d2522d32f4abc430e860d9b1bc7
address
bc1qfw0tdgneg4wj2gkn9a9tcscwscxekx78jug0x5
transaction
ce233e31aa19d0c42d843170549a64dea433495e02a1385bd24836b3665183f6
confirmations
118822
spent
true